Canon SD960 IS vs Ricoh WG-30W Overview
On this page, we are comparing the Canon SD960 IS vs Ricoh WG-30W, one being a Small Sensor Compact and the other is a Waterproof by rivals Canon and Ricoh. There exists a significant gap between the image resolutions of the SD960 IS (12MP) and WG-30W (16MP) but both cameras have the same sensor measurements (1/2.3").

The SD960 IS was released 6 years earlier than the WG-30W and that is quite a sizable gap as far as technology is concerned. Each of these cameras have the same body design (Compact).

Canon SD960 IS vs Ricoh WG-30W Physical Comparison
For anybody who is intending to carry your camera often, you're going to have to take into account its weight and volume. The Canon SD960 IS has got exterior measurements of 98mm x 54mm x 22mm (3.9" x 2.1" x 0.9") along with a weight of 145 grams (0.32 lbs) and the Ricoh WG-30W has sizing of 123mm x 62mm x 30mm (4.8" x 2.4" x 1.2") with a weight of 194 grams (0.43 lbs).

Canon SD960 IS vs Ricoh WG-30W Sensor Comparison
Normally, it's tough to visualise the gap between sensor sizing purely by going over a spec sheet. The visual underneath should give you a far better sense of the sensor measurements in the SD960 IS and WG-30W.
As you can see, both of those cameras provide the same sensor dimensions but not the same megapixels. You should anticipate the Ricoh WG-30W to deliver more detail as a result of its extra 4MP. Greater resolution will also allow you to crop images more aggressively. The older SD960 IS is going to be behind in sensor innovation.
